Let’s go deeper into the definition of Kundalini Yoga
Kundalini yoga is an ancient art and science that deals with the transformation and expansion of consciousness, the chakras have to be awakened in order to awaken the Kundalini energy. The activation and balancing of the chakras are accomplished by merging and uniting prana with apana (cosmic energy). Pranayama, Bandha, Kriyas, Asanas, Mudras and Mantras are used to awaken the Kundalini.
Kundalini Yoga is influenced by the Shakta sect and Tantra schools of Hinduism. Kundalini energy can be awakened through the regular practice of mantra, tantra, yantra, yoga, or meditation. Due to the involvement of subtle energies, Kundalini yoga is recognized as the most dangerous form of yoga.
It is derived from the Sanskrit word Kundalini which means circular or annular and refers to the formation of a snake’s coil. Kundalini Yoga is a mixture of Bhakti Yoga (the yogic practice of devotion and chanting), Raja Yoga (mediation/practice of mental and physical control) and Shakti Yoga, (for the manifestation of power and energy).
